Transaction 534a239056fa60a7d33ae7314508cec9cac438c66855409109c5452e55f42718
1 Input
1 Output
-
534a239056fa60a7d33ae7314508cec9cac438c66855409109c5452e55f42718:0
- value
- 784289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 853340aff60122d57e71403662497960dd353699 OP_EQUAL
- address
- 3DqKCA1eJdKVrjAeCGEBMfwA534B6XiACY